Fisker will produce 100 Fisker Extreme Vigyan Edition SUVs for the India market. Fisker expects to complete the homologation process for India by September and to commence deliveries in Q4 2023.

Fisker Inc. announced on Monday it will produce 100 Fisker Ocean Extreme Vigyan Edition all-electric SUVs for the India market.

“India offers exciting opportunities for us,” Chairman and CEO Henrik Fisker said. “Following the successful start of deliveries in Europe and the US, we’re thrilled that we can bring the Fisker Ocean Extreme, with its class-leading range and unique features, to a new market where we plan to grow our brand rapidly over the coming years.”

Fisker established an office in Hyderabad in 2022. The company expects to homologate the Fisker Ocean Extreme Vigyan Edition, named for the company’s India subsidiary, by September. Deliveries to the world’s third-largest automotive market will commence in Q4 2023. Pricing will align with Europe — where the Fisker Ocean Extreme is priced at 69,950 EUR for the German market — plus import taxes and logistics for India.

The Fisker Ocean Extreme has an EPA range of 360 miles on standard 20-inch wheels and tires, which is the longest range of any new electric SUV in its class. In Europe, the Fisker Ocean Extreme has a WLTP range of 707km/440 UK miles on standard 20-inch wheels and tires, which is the longest range of any electric SUV sold in Europe today.
